Why Combine a 12V Inverter with a Three-Phase Sewage Pump?
In wastewater management, reliability is non-negotiable. A 12V inverter converts DC power from batteries or solar panels into stable AC power, enabling three-phase sewage pumps to operate seamlessly in off-grid or unstable grid environments. FAQ
Q: Can I use car batteries with these inverters? A: Yes, but deep-cycle batteries perform better for continuous operation.
Q: How long do these systems typically last? A: Properly maintained systems operate 8-12 years before major component replacement.
